Abstract
We prove a new variant of the energy-capacity inequality for closed rational symplectic manifolds (as well as certain open manifolds such as cotangent bundle of closed manifolds...) and we derive some consequences to C^0-symplectic topology. Namely, we prove that a continuous function which is a uniform limit of smooth Hamiltonians whose flows converge to the identity for the spectral (or Hofer's) distance must vanish. This gives a new proof of uniqueness of continuous generating Hamiltonian for hameomorphisms. This also allows us to improve a result by Cardin and Viterbo on the C^0-rigidity of the Poisson bracket.
